Gentoo Archives: gentoo-commits

From: Sergei Trofimovich <slyfox@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-haskell/cabal/
Date: Sun, 01 Nov 2020 13:59:04
Message-Id: 1604239072.6eb09f115ed0c281d77a4ae1543b0eb43b9845cb.slyfox@gentoo
1 commit: 6eb09f115ed0c281d77a4ae1543b0eb43b9845cb
2 Author: Sergei Trofimovich <slyfox <AT> gentoo <DOT> org>
3 AuthorDate: Sun Nov 1 13:57:52 2020 +0000
4 Commit: Sergei Trofimovich <slyfox <AT> gentoo <DOT> org>
5 CommitDate: Sun Nov 1 13:57:52 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=6eb09f11
7
8 dev-haskell/cabal: update to EAPI=7
9
10 Package-Manager: Portage-3.0.8, Repoman-3.0.2
11 Signed-off-by: Sergei Trofimovich <slyfox <AT> gentoo.org>
12
13 dev-haskell/cabal/cabal-1.18.1.3.ebuild | 4 +++-
14 dev-haskell/cabal/cabal-1.18.1.5.ebuild | 4 +++-
15 dev-haskell/cabal/cabal-1.20.0.2.ebuild | 4 +++-
16 dev-haskell/cabal/cabal-1.22.8.0.ebuild | 4 +++-
17 4 files changed, 12 insertions(+), 4 deletions(-)
18
19 diff --git a/dev-haskell/cabal/cabal-1.18.1.3.ebuild b/dev-haskell/cabal/cabal-1.18.1.3.ebuild
20 index b4a410cf4d3..c48c74d40c4 100644
21 --- a/dev-haskell/cabal/cabal-1.18.1.3.ebuild
22 +++ b/dev-haskell/cabal/cabal-1.18.1.3.ebuild
23 @@ -1,7 +1,7 @@
24 # Copyright 1999-2020 Gentoo Authors
25 # Distributed under the terms of the GNU General Public License v2
26
27 -EAPI=5
28 +EAPI=7
29
30 # ebuild generated by hackport 0.3.6.9999
31
32 @@ -37,6 +37,8 @@ S="${WORKDIR}/${MY_PN}-${PV}"
33 CABAL_CORE_LIB_GHC_PV="7.8.2014* 7.8.0.2014* 7.8.1 7.8.2 7.8.3 7.8.3.20141119"
34
35 src_prepare() {
36 + default
37 +
38 if [[ -n ${LIVE_EBUILD} ]]; then
39 CABAL_FILE=${MY_PN}.cabal cabal_chdeps 'version: 1.17.0' "version: ${PV}"
40 fi
41
42 diff --git a/dev-haskell/cabal/cabal-1.18.1.5.ebuild b/dev-haskell/cabal/cabal-1.18.1.5.ebuild
43 index 369324fa471..220ee8187a5 100644
44 --- a/dev-haskell/cabal/cabal-1.18.1.5.ebuild
45 +++ b/dev-haskell/cabal/cabal-1.18.1.5.ebuild
46 @@ -1,7 +1,7 @@
47 # Copyright 1999-2020 Gentoo Authors
48 # Distributed under the terms of the GNU General Public License v2
49
50 -EAPI=5
51 +EAPI=7
52
53 # ebuild generated by hackport 0.3.6.9999
54
55 @@ -39,6 +39,8 @@ S="${WORKDIR}/${MY_PN}-${PV}"
56 CABAL_CORE_LIB_GHC_PV="7.8.4"
57
58 src_prepare() {
59 + default
60 +
61 if [[ -n ${LIVE_EBUILD} ]]; then
62 CABAL_FILE=${MY_PN}.cabal cabal_chdeps 'version: 1.17.0' "version: ${PV}"
63 fi
64
65 diff --git a/dev-haskell/cabal/cabal-1.20.0.2.ebuild b/dev-haskell/cabal/cabal-1.20.0.2.ebuild
66 index abbfa9df88f..de5558e4a3a 100644
67 --- a/dev-haskell/cabal/cabal-1.20.0.2.ebuild
68 +++ b/dev-haskell/cabal/cabal-1.20.0.2.ebuild
69 @@ -1,7 +1,7 @@
70 # Copyright 1999-2020 Gentoo Authors
71 # Distributed under the terms of the GNU General Public License v2
72
73 -EAPI=5
74 +EAPI=7
75
76 # ebuild generated by hackport 0.4.9999
77
78 @@ -36,6 +36,8 @@ DEPEND="${RDEPEND}
79 S="${WORKDIR}/${MY_PN}-${PV}"
80
81 src_prepare() {
82 + default
83 +
84 if [[ -n ${LIVE_EBUILD} ]]; then
85 CABAL_FILE=${MY_PN}.cabal cabal_chdeps 'version: 1.17.0' "version: ${PV}"
86 fi
87
88 diff --git a/dev-haskell/cabal/cabal-1.22.8.0.ebuild b/dev-haskell/cabal/cabal-1.22.8.0.ebuild
89 index c42d09e543c..15fd12acb3a 100644
90 --- a/dev-haskell/cabal/cabal-1.22.8.0.ebuild
91 +++ b/dev-haskell/cabal/cabal-1.22.8.0.ebuild
92 @@ -1,7 +1,7 @@
93 # Copyright 1999-2020 Gentoo Authors
94 # Distributed under the terms of the GNU General Public License v2
95
96 -EAPI=5
97 +EAPI=7
98
99 # ebuild generated by hackport 0.4.5.9999
100
101 @@ -37,6 +37,8 @@ DEPEND="${RDEPEND}
102 S="${WORKDIR}/${MY_PN}-${PV}"
103
104 src_prepare() {
105 + default
106 +
107 if [[ -n ${LIVE_EBUILD} ]]; then
108 CABAL_FILE=${MY_PN}.cabal cabal_chdeps 'version: 1.17.0' "version: ${PV}"
109 fi